Fynn Wörth
Fynn Wörth is currently pursuing an interdisciplinary bachelor’s
degree with the major subject Music and the minor subject German
studies at Hanover University of Music, Drama and Media and Leibniz
University Hanover. His academic interests center around popular
music and cultural analysis. Both participated in various musicology
seminars, including “Pop Music and Human-Animal Studies” taught
by Benjamin Burkhart, and held a short presentation on the topic of
this abstract within the context of the seminar.
